Output a3dd458643911809d9b586578dae34291b6cfce4e91672e3dea727c22c68c371:2

value
270000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42bc3ebda4b5316fd605d760716bf9a11371e66a OP_EQUAL
address
37mt2hg8d64qG1W64HJfxcwtB47jiVCB3o
transaction
a3dd458643911809d9b586578dae34291b6cfce4e91672e3dea727c22c68c371
spent
true